I was driving 70 mph on the right most northbound lane of I-75 at mile marker 452 in Florida. The road had become wet from recent rain. The rear of my car suddenly started fishtailing to the right. The fishtail evolved into full-blown counterclockwise spins which took the car all the way to the guardrail in the middle shoulder. The impact resulted in the car being totaled. I believe a defect with the ABS, electronic stability control system or the all wheel drive caused the accident. The road was perfectly straight, and I didn't apply the brakes or make any sudden steering changes. I reported the incident to Subaru and asked for an investigation of the wrecked car. Despite three letters and a complete report, the company refused to inspect the car.
